Zwikelmania is basically an awesome thing that Oregon Brewers Guild presents. So once a year some of the private or small local breweries open their doors to beer lovers. You get a factory tour, taste their new and/or award winning beers, talk to the beer makers and basically get to appreciate what it takes to make that awesome beer you love :)
For this year's Zwikelmania, we visited two local breweries - Laurelwood and Hopworks. We had the most amazing time, both of us Mr. Hubby and myself love beer, him admittedly more so but nevertheless I can appreciate a good stout or amber :)
Laurelwood
This is probably one of the smallest breweries I have been to. But man oh man, it may be small in size but its big on flavor! They make about 8000 barrels a year with only four people on staff. Can you imagine? Of course, that makes em' ridiculously busy BUT considering they can actually influence every pint of beer that leaves the brewery. Amazing!
